site stats

Unable to infer schema for csv pyspark

WebI was solving the same issue, that I wanted all the columns as text and deal with correct cast later which I have solved by recasting all the column to string after I've inferred the … Web26 Aug 2024 · Viewed 27k times. 3. I'm using databricks and trying to read in a csv file like this: df = (spark.read .option ("header", "true") .option ("inferSchema", "true") .csv …

databricks/spark-csv: CSV Data Source for Apache Spark 1.x - GitHub

http://nadbordrozd.github.io/blog/2016/05/22/one-weird-trick-that-will-fix-your-pyspark-schemas/ Web16 Mar 2024 · When inferring schema for CSV data, Auto Loader assumes that the files contain headers. If your CSV files do not contain headers, provide the option … greenville scottish games https://cantinelle.com

Spark Dataframe Basics - Learning Journal

Web14 Jul 2024 · hi Muji, Great job 🙂. just missing a ',' after : B_df("_c1").cast(StringType).as("S_STORE_ID") // Assign column names to the Region dataframe val storeDF = B_df ... Web16 Jan 2024 · Once executed, you will see a warning saying that "inferring schema from dict is deprecated, please use pyspark.sql.Row instead". However this deprecation warning is … Web22 Oct 2024 · The text was updated successfully, but these errors were encountered: greenville sc nurseries and greenhouses

DataFrameReader — Loading Data From External Data Sources · …

Category:Unable To Infer Schema For Csv In Pyspark - CopyProgramming

Tags:Unable to infer schema for csv pyspark

Unable to infer schema for csv pyspark

Spark Dataframe Basics - Learning Journal

Web7 Dec 2024 · It is an expensive operation because Spark must automatically go through the CSV file and infer the schema for each column. Reading CSV using user-defined Schema. The preferred option while reading any file would be to enforce a custom schema, this ensures that the data types are consistent and avoids any unexpected behavior. In order … Web9 Jan 2024 · CSV Data Source for Apache Spark 1.x. NOTE: This functionality has been inlined in Apache Spark 2.x. This package is in maintenance mode and we only accept critical bug fixes. A library for parsing and querying CSV data with Apache Spark, for Spark SQL and DataFrames. Requirements. This library requires Spark 1.3+ Linking

Unable to infer schema for csv pyspark

Did you know?

Webinfers the input schema automatically from data. It requires one extra pass over the data. If None is set, it uses the default value, false. enforceSchemastr or bool, optional If it is set to true, the specified or inferred schema will be forcibly applied to datasource files, and headers in CSV files will be ignored. Web21 Jan 2024 · pyspark.sql.utils.AnalysisException: 'Unable to infer schema for CSV. It must be specified manually.;'. spark.read.option ("header", "true").csv ("s3://...") …

Web22 May 2016 · The first two sections consist of me complaining about schemas and the remaining two offer what I think is a neat way of creating a schema from a dict (or a dataframe from an rdd of dicts). The Good, the Bad and the Ugly of dataframes. Dataframes in pyspark are simultaneously pretty great and kind of completely broken. they enforce a … Webschema allows for specifying the schema of a data source (that the DataFrameReader is about to read a dataset from). import org.apache.spark.sql.types. StructType val schema = new StructType () ... Some formats can infer schema from datasets (e.g. csv or json) using inferSchema option. Tip.

Web11 May 2024 · As you can see Spark did a lot of work behind the scenes: it read each line from the file, deserialized the JSON, inferred a schema, and merged the schemas together into one global schema for the whole dataset, filling missing values with null when necessary. All of this work is great, but it can slow things down quite a lot, particularly in … Web25 Jun 2024 · If you don't infer the schema then, of course, it would work since everything will be cast, When you will run the streaming query again, the schema will be inferred., For ad-hoc use cases, you can reenable schema inference by setting spark.sql.streaming.schemaInference Mary Darnell2024-10-08 Unable to read csv …

Web26 Jun 2024 · Spark infers the types based on the row values when you don’t explicitly provides types. Use the schema attribute to fetch the actual schema object associated with a DataFrame. df.schema. StructType(List(StructField(num,LongType,true),StructField(letter,StringType,true))) The …

fnf the nicky verseWebIf it is set to true, the specified or inferred schema will be forcibly applied to datasource files, and headers in CSV files will be ignored. If the option is set to false, the schema will be … greenville scottish paradeWeb30 May 2024 · I also came across this issue, but my context was a job running on AWS Glue after upgrading to Glue 3.0. The comments about the checkpoint file being empty lead me to the correct solution: Glue 3.0 deprecated HDFS, but existing checkpoint directory settings weren't altered so the ConnectedComponents I/O failed quietly (e.g., my setting was for … fnf the nft manWebIgnore Missing Files. Spark allows you to use the configuration spark.sql.files.ignoreMissingFiles or the data source option ignoreMissingFiles to ignore missing files while reading data from files. Here, missing file really means the deleted file under directory after you construct the DataFrame.When set to true, the Spark jobs will … greenville scottish riteWeb7 Feb 2024 · By default Spark SQL infer schema while reading JSON file, but, we can ignore this and read a JSON with schema (user-defined) using spark.read.schema ("schema") method. What is Spark Schema. Spark Schema defines the structure of the data (column name, datatype, nested columns, nullable e.t.c), and when it specified while reading a file ... fnf the origami king full gameWeb8 Jul 2024 · @rishabh-cldcvr Thank you for bringing this scenario to our attention. I might be helpful if you detail what you are attempting under the context of OPENROWSET, as I am not completely clear with regard to your question.Let me explain, the OPENROWSET returns a data set from external data sources, and is limited in that it is an easy way to return … fnf the origami king downloadWeb18 Dec 2024 · Creates a DataFrame from an RDD, a list or a pandas.DataFrame. When schema is None, it will try to infer the schema (column names and types) from data, which should be an RDD of either Row, namedtuple, or dict. If schema inference is needed, samplingRatio is used to determined the ratio of rows used for schema inference. fnf the puppet master